Some New Results in the Theory of Recurrent Events - A Preliminary Report.

Abstract

The main focus of the work is to obtain approximate formulae for u(n), the expected number of occurrences of an aperiodic recurrent event at time n. The formulae are all of the type u(n)=psi(n) + rho(n), where psi(n) is explicitly calculable in terms of known features of the model and rho(n) is a remainder term tending to zero as n approaches the limit of infinity. The thrust of the work lies in showing the way in which assumptions about the underlying model are reflected by rho(n).
